>For the last 4-days, our (otherwise OK) 5.4-RELEASE machine has been
>reporting:
>
>Feb 12 12:08:05 : ad0: TIMEOUT - WRITE_DMA retrying (2 retries left) =
LBA=3D2701279
>Feb 13 00:08:51 : ad0: TIMEOUT - WRITE_DMA retrying (2 retries left) =
LBA=3D2701279
>Feb 13 12:09:38 : ad0: TIMEOUT - WRITE_DMA retrying (2 retries left) =
LBA=3D2963331
>Feb 14 00:10:24 : ad0: TIMEOUT - WRITE_DMA retrying (2 retries left) =
LBA=3D2705947
>
>So -- can anyone help track this down?


It sounds like a hardware issue.  Install
/usr/ports/sysutils/smartmontools and "ask" the drive to see whats up.
